Whole Heart Free-breathing Extracellular Volume Mapping at 3.0 Tesla

Pieternel van der Tol 1 , Qian Tao 1 , Rob J. van der Geest 1 , and Hildo J. Lamb 1

1 Department of Radiology, Leiden University Medical Center, Leiden, Netherlands

Extracellular volume fraction (ECV) of the myocardium can provide a quantitative measure for cardiomyopathies. In our research we propose the use of a free breathing T1-mapping method combined with dedicated post processing to acquire whole heart ECV maps based on native and post contrast T1-maps. We compared this method to the MOLLI T1-mapping method, and found a non-significant bias towards higher ECV for our method. The proposed method facilitates whole heart ECV mapping in the same amount of time as MOLLI, however it circumvents the need for multiple breath holds, making it more suitable for patients.
